Q: Is 113,411,898 a Prime Number?

 A: No, 113,411,898 is not a prime number.

Why is 113,411,898 not a prime number?

A prime number is a natural number, greater than one, that can only be divided by 1 and itself.

The number 113411898 can be evenly divided by 1 2 3 6 9 18 43 86 129 258 387 774 146,527 293,054 439,581 879,162 1,318,743 2,637,486 6,300,661 12,601,322 18,901,983 37,803,966 56,705,949 and 113,411,898, with no remainder.

Since 113,411,898 cannot be divided by just 1 and 113,411,898, it is not a prime number.
